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
2960 connectés 

  FORUM HardWare.fr
  Linux et OS Alternatifs
  Logiciels

  svn avec ssh : svnserver n'est pas dans le PATH par default

 


 Mot :   Pseudo :  
 
Bas de page
Auteur Sujet :

svn avec ssh : svnserver n'est pas dans le PATH par default

n°833883
zapan666
Tout est relatif
Posté le 09-08-2006 à 14:41:21  profilanswer
 

Bjrs
 
sur un serveur où je n'ai pas un accès root, je veux mettre subversion.
Pour commiter/etc les users devront passer par ssh (pour plusieurs raison)
 
le problème est que subversion est placé dans un repertoire spécial qui n'est pas dans le PATH des utilisateurs.
 
Je le fais donc ajouter aux utilisateurs dans leur PATH via leur bash_rc.
 
Mais pas de chance, le client subversion ne prend pas en compte cette modif et du coup, leur d'un checkout, je me retrouve avec un svnserver : command not found  [:fez666]  
 
Ce "problème" est décrit dans la FAQ de subversion, la solution qu'il propose est de faire une clé ssh spécial pour subversion avec dedans le chemin vers svnserver.  
 
Le problème est que la méthode est trop complexe a mettre en place (création d'une clé, etc) or je voudrais proposer quelque chose de simple à mettre en place (et indépendant de root, sinon ça sera jamais fais...).
 
Savez vous si il y a un moyen de faire marcher tout ça via ssh et en même temps l'utilisation de svn ne soit pas complexifié par 10 pour les utilisateurs ?  
 
Merci  [:briseparpaing]


---------------
my flick r - Just Tab it !
mood
Publicité
Posté le 09-08-2006 à 14:41:21  profilanswer
 

n°834631
zapan666
Tout est relatif
Posté le 12-08-2006 à 02:09:42  profilanswer
 

[:mad_overclocker] up
 
C'est pour aider des élèves,  [:cupra]


---------------
my flick r - Just Tab it !
n°834634
farib
Posté le 12-08-2006 à 05:25:55  profilanswer
 

bah en gros on va pas être super capables de faire mieux que la FAQ [:spamafote]
 
Sinon chais pas, tu peux ptet essayer un websvn en https

n°846460
zapan666
Tout est relatif
Posté le 27-09-2006 à 16:34:05  profilanswer
 

Bon, j'ai testé la solutation de la FAQ : ça marche top nikel.
 
Par contre "gros" probleme, quand je me connecte via ssh, il utilise la clé et en même temps la commande, du coup, je peux plus utiliser le bash ! (je me retrouve sur svnserver...)
 
Comment faire pour que, dans la normale, ça utilise le bash, et uniquement quand je le veux, ça utilise la clé qui pointe sur svnserver ? (euh, et comment faire pour indiquer que je veux utiliser cette clé ?)


Message édité par zapan666 le 27-09-2006 à 16:35:05

---------------
my flick r - Just Tab it !
n°846463
memaster
ki a volé mon 62?
Posté le 27-09-2006 à 16:43:54  profilanswer
 

et faire un lien symbolique de svnserver dans le repertoire de l'utilisateur?
et mettre le bit uid de l'executable?

Message cité 1 fois
Message édité par memaster le 27-09-2006 à 16:44:10
n°846464
zapan666
Tout est relatif
Posté le 27-09-2006 à 16:47:08  profilanswer
 

memaster a écrit :

et faire un lien symbolique de svnserver dans le repertoire de l'utilisateur?
et mettre le bit uid de l'executable?


bah euh, j'ai pas trop pensé à ça.
 
Mais pour mon problème de clé, en fait il y a eux des pertes à la traduction : il faut faire deux clés différentes, une pour la connexion ssh normale et l'autre pour subversion, et op, ça marche


---------------
my flick r - Just Tab it !

Aller à :
Ajouter une réponse
  FORUM HardWare.fr
  Linux et OS Alternatifs
  Logiciels

  svn avec ssh : svnserver n'est pas dans le PATH par default

 

Sujets relatifs
Problème de PATH ?Modifier Executable Path
Sid et Xorg could not open default font : 'fixed'[PATH] Au sujet d'exporte truc_path=
PATH perdu[RESOLUE][Terminaux] pb de path
rajouter application dans le path de kde 3.4changer partition par default dans mrbooter
Probleme de PATH avec java :-\Problème de path
Plus de sujets relatifs à : svn avec ssh : svnserver n'est pas dans le PATH par default


Copyright © 1997-2025 Groupe LDLC (Signaler un contenu illicite / Données personnelles)